In the wake of the current COVID-19 Pandemic CRA looks to extend the Tax-Filing Deadline to June 1st 2020.

Quote:
OTTAWA — Canadians will have one extra month to file their taxes to the Canada Revenue Agency, the National Post has learned.

The announcement will be made tomorrow by federal ministers as part of a larger series of financial measures to assist Canadian individuals and governments through the COVID-19 pandemic.

So instead of an April 30 filing deadline for the 2020 tax filing season, Canadians will have until June 1 to submit their income tax return to CRA. The deadline to pay off any outstanding balances interest-free will also be extended, this time to July 31.

Payment deadline extension
The CRA is extending the payment due date for current year individual, corporate, and trust income tax returns, including instalment payments, from September 1, 2020, to September 30, 2020. Penalties and interest will not be charged if payments are made by the extended deadline of September 30, 2020. This includes the late-filing penalty as long as the return is filed by September 30, 2020.
https://www.canada.ca/en/revenue-age...vid-19-pa.html

As indicated, the Deadline has been extended an additional month to the end of September.

I'm not going to get into a long rant, but basically everyone was expecting to be given more time.

And when I say everyone....I mean 'everyone.'

I understand that the Government couldnt and wouldnt do it. BUt they should have just said so in February. Slips came out late, people had no idea that they needed to claim their CERB, their emergency benefits came out in 2 different slips so some people missed them, banks werent filing investment slips....

Because everyone thought they had more time.

The problem is, I deal with people. Not giant corporations that than can afford penalties and interest and generally dont care, but actual humans. This is their money.

So it basically put a loaded gun to my head to get it all done while everyone around me waited until the very, very last minute.

It was unpleasant.
